Meaning

Lightweight materials, in the context of this market, refer to materials that possess high strength-to-weight ratios, making them ideal for applications where reducing overall weight is critical. These materials, including advanced composites, aluminum, and high-strength steel, find applications in automotive, aerospace, and construction industries, among others.

Key Market Insights

  1. Automotive Sector Dominance: The automotive industry in Europe is a major consumer of lightweight materials. Stringent emission standards and the push for electric vehicles have heightened the demand for materials that contribute to weight reduction.
  2. Aerospace Applications: Lightweight materials play a crucial role in the aerospace sector, where every kilogram saved translates to fuel efficiency and operational cost savings. The adoption of advanced composites is particularly notable in aircraft manufacturing.
  3. Sustainability Focus: The European market has witnessed a growing focus on sustainable materials. Lightweight materials that are recyclable and offer energy savings align with the region’s commitment to environmental stewardship.
  4. Technological Advancements: Ongoing research and development efforts have led to innovations in lightweight materials, including the development of new alloys, composites, and manufacturing processes, further driving market growth.

Market Drivers

  1. Fuel Efficiency Requirements: The stringent fuel efficiency standards imposed on the automotive and aerospace industries drive the demand for lightweight materials, as reducing weight directly contributes to enhanced fuel efficiency.
  2. Emission Reduction Targets: Europe’s commitment to reducing carbon emissions places pressure on industries to adopt materials that contribute to lighter and more fuel-efficient products, thereby supporting environmental goals.
  3. Advancements in Material Science: Continuous advancements in material science, including the development of nanomaterials and advanced composites, offer new possibilities for lightweight construction and contribute to market growth.
  4. Innovations in Manufacturing: Innovations in manufacturing processes, such as additive manufacturing and lightweighting techniques, contribute to the scalability and cost-effectiveness of producing lightweight materials.

Market Restraints

  1. Cost Considerations: Despite the long-term benefits, the initial cost of lightweight materials can be higher than traditional materials, posing a challenge to widespread adoption, particularly in cost-sensitive industries.
  2. Resistance to Change: Established industries may exhibit resistance to change, making it challenging to transition from traditional materials to lightweight alternatives, even when the benefits are evident.
  3. Recycling Challenges: Some lightweight materials pose challenges in terms of recyclability. Developing efficient recycling processes is crucial to addressing the environmental concerns associated with these materials.
  4. Limited Raw Material Availability: The availability of certain raw materials used in lightweight materials, such as rare earth elements, may pose challenges in terms of supply chain stability and pricing.

Market Opportunities

  1. Electric Vehicles Market: The rising adoption of electric vehicles in Europe presents a significant opportunity for lightweight materials. These materials contribute to extending the range of electric vehicles and improving overall efficiency.
  2. Renewable Energy Infrastructure: Lightweight materials play a role in the construction of renewable energy infrastructure, such as wind turbines. Their use can enhance the efficiency and durability of these structures.
  3. Collaborations for Innovation: Collaborations between research institutions, industry players, and government bodies can foster innovation in lightweight materials, creating opportunities for the development of new materials and applications.
  4. Government Initiatives: Supportive government policies and incentives aimed at promoting the use of lightweight materials in various industries can spur market growth and create a conducive environment for adoption.

Market Key Trends

  1. Recyclable Lightweight Materials: The market is witnessing a trend towards the development of lightweight materials that are easily recyclable, aligning with circular economy principles.
  2. Smart Lightweight Materials: Integration of smart technologies, such as sensors and data analytics, into lightweight materials enhances their functionality and opens new possibilities for innovation.
  3. 3D Printing in Lightweighting: The application of 3D printing technology in manufacturing lightweight components offers flexibility, customization, and material efficiency.
  4. Bio-based Lightweight Materials: The emergence of bio-based lightweight materials presents sustainable alternatives, reducing dependence on traditional petrochemical-derived materials.
